What's Happening?
UKG, a prominent global AI platform specializing in HR, pay, and workforce management, has introduced UKG Pro Pay with Workforce AI. This new system is designed to transform payroll processes into a real-time, action-oriented system, ensuring accurate
and timely payments for employees, particularly those in frontline and hourly roles. The system utilizes agentic, assistive, and generative AI, along with advanced automation, to identify and resolve payroll issues before they impact employees. This innovation aims to replace fragmented, manual payroll processes with real-time orchestration, thereby simplifying complexity and supporting more accurate payroll operations at scale. The introduction of this system was announced at the Payroll Congress 2026, highlighting its potential to significantly reduce payroll errors and enhance the overall employee experience.
Why It's Important?
The introduction of UKG Pro Pay with Workforce AI is significant as it addresses the critical issue of payroll accuracy, which is a major concern for organizations, especially those with a large frontline workforce. Payroll errors can lead to financial losses and impact employee satisfaction and trust. According to research by UKG and KPMG, organizations can lose 2-4% of total labor spend due to 'payroll leakage,' which refers to unintended financial losses. By implementing this AI-powered system, organizations can potentially save millions by reducing wasteful payroll spending. Moreover, the system's ability to provide real-time solutions and reduce manual processes can transform payroll departments from reactive to strategic partners, enhancing their role within organizations.
